Why did Alaska brake away from the northwest territories?

Alaska did not break away from the Northwest Territories; rather, it was purchased from Russia by the United States in 1867 and became a separate territory. The Northwest Territories are part of Canada, and Alaska is a U.S. state. The two regions have distinct historical and political developments, with Alaska being acquired due to its strategic location and Natural Resources. The separation is rooted in colonial expansion by different nations rather than a breakup of a singular entity.
